5 affcfg 'lifanz .I They have put off their Shoes Softly to walk by day W'ithin our thoughts, to tread At night our dream-led paths Of sleep. -I I ll gf: Rnlzfrl Urr One Thousand and thirty-Seven men and women Of Cornell Served their country in the armed forces during XfVorld War ll. Of these, the following thirty-five are known to have paid tlIe supreme sacrifice. ln honoring them Cornell extends her gratitude to all her gallant sons and daughters. THOMAS ARL.ANDO BALDWIN '22 PAUL HERBERT BELLAMY '43 VERNELHOWARD DERRER '34 CHARLES LOUIS DULIN, JR. '42 DONALD FREDERICK FISH '43 HUGH GORDON FORD '45 EDWARD JACKSON GANSON '45 DEAN WILLIS GILLIATT '42 'THEODORE FRANCIS GOLAN '46 VVALTER ORVILLE HAI,OUPEK, '43 HARVEY PAUL HANSON '45 JOHN FRANCIS HEALY '40 WILLIAM FREDERICK HOI.CH '43 ALLEN HENRY JOSEPH '44 JOHN PAUL KRAUSE '39 RAY JACK KROPF '41 CHARLES HERMAN KRULL '44 FLOYD GORTON NICCREERY '28 HOWARD WILLOUGHEY RIERKEL '39 HARLAN LEROY NELSON '42 PAUL RICHARD REYNOLDS '46 WILLIAM RILEY RICHARDSON '22 ROBERT CLAIRE SANDERSON '44 RUSSELL RAEE STARK '40 BENJAMIN HOWELL STEDMAN '40 WILLIAM HENRY STEVENS, JR. '45 JoHN..EI,LIOTT FFITUS '41 EUGENE RIERLE 'FORNQUIST '41 ROEERT EUGENE WARFEL '40 WILLIAM STAPLETON WATSON '40 DONALD QUINCY WILLIAMS '43 WENDELL EUGENE VVILSON '40 VVOODROW WILSON XVISSLER '39 JOHN HENRY WVOLFE '36 ROBERT EDGECUMBE YAW '47 06:fOc90:
